misfiring. code p0300 most likly . check usual , plug wires connection ,plugs. have you done any mods recently?

You need to get the codes scanned before doing anything....it could be a random misfire, or just 1 cylinder.......a bad front 02 sensor or even a dirty or fauty MAF can cause a misfire.....

any suggestions on plugs and wires

 

NGK TR55ix Iridium plugs (NGK part # 7164)

 

Taylor 409 10.4mm wires in red (Taylor part # 79205) they are also available in blue, don't know the part number......
